Output eaa687b307f270a317809bd9f9ad78f3941b20267043feb40ab35a427610fc9f:1

value
138750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b703811d78996760143640bcc0c27b18dd0ab1d OP_EQUALVERIFY OP_CHECKSIG
address
17st7W6WwFng7H4cnDBSfB3Bz5VbwQLYru
transaction
eaa687b307f270a317809bd9f9ad78f3941b20267043feb40ab35a427610fc9f
confirmations
668169
spent
true